Transaction 0c70645fe79e3b82a5e0f7d585142e77293fab5662f551a53819555fa9677228

2 Input
2 Outputs
  • 0c70645fe79e3b82a5e0f7d585142e77293fab5662f551a53819555fa9677228:0
  • value  50000000
    address  13EB3kNJRHnEqNT22cVrhxoZcBEewDMazf
  • 0c70645fe79e3b82a5e0f7d585142e77293fab5662f551a53819555fa9677228:1
  • value  37431011
    address  bc1qttqvmzysgwluevs5n99dejrw5uc56a56gch9vq